Hi Olivier, On top of the GL_SELECT regressions reported by Brian, this patch series is causing regressions on i915g for:
draw-instanced draw-instanced-divisor draw-elements-instanced-base-vertex draw-elements-instanced-base-vertex-user_varrays draw-non-instanced instance-array-dereference Stéphane On Thu, Jun 21, 2012 at 10:39 AM, Olivier Galibert <galib...@pobox.com> wrote: > On Thu, Jun 21, 2012 at 10:28:22AM -0700, Jose Fonseca wrote: >> This patch series is causing regressions in select/feedback mode.
